| Roles Classification |
|---|
| Biological Roles: | analgesic An agent capable of relieving pain without the loss of consciousness or without producing anaesthesia. In addition, analgesic is a role played by a compound which is exhibited by a capability to cause a reduction of pain symptoms. marine metabolite Any metabolite produced during a metabolic reaction in marine macro- and microorganisms. |

| Outgoing Relation(s) |
| bunodosine 391 (CHEBI:68296) has role analgesic (CHEBI:35480) |
| bunodosine 391 (CHEBI:68296) has role marine metabolite (CHEBI:76507) |
| bunodosine 391 (CHEBI:68296) is a L-histidine derivative (CHEBI:84076) |
| bunodosine 391 (CHEBI:68296) is a indoles (CHEBI:24828) |
| bunodosine 391 (CHEBI:68296) is a monocarboxylic acid amide (CHEBI:29347) |
| bunodosine 391 (CHEBI:68296) is a organobromine compound (CHEBI:37141) |
| IUPAC Name |
|---|
| N-[(6-bromo-1H-indol-3-yl)acetyl]-L-histidine |
